A crocodile killed a pregnant woman in Papua New Guinea on the same day a wild pig killed a 14-year-old boy in the same area.
Police in West New Britain, in PNG's north island province, killed the crocodile last Friday after it took a 23-year-old pregnant woman while she bathed in the Tulup river near Garmate village.
On the same day, a young boy was killed during a hunting expedition at Kilenge village in an unrelated attack, police chief Richard Mulou said.
